What's in the Cellar?
An episode of the Tales from the Orne Library podcast, hosted by Jacob Walker, titled "What's in the Cellar?" was published on October 3, 2021 and runs 55 minutes.
October 3, 2021 ·55m · Tales from the Orne Library
Summary
Faced with execution for a murder he claims he didn't commit, Arthur Blackwood puts forth a desperate plea to his law partner, Joseph Kline. Kline hires Harold Knight and Psychologist Norman Versailles. Together, they must search the Blackwood's summer cabin for whatever scraps of evidence they can find to prove his innocence. Blackwood claims that there is a monster in the cabin, but can this wild claim be true?
